Hey this has probably been discussed before but i havnt had any luck finding it, is it worth changing the S54 tranny on my Celica GT to the Celica ST tranny C52?
Also can this even be done (im assuming it can) Ratios are: C52 - 3.166, 1.904, 1.310, 0.969, 0.815 S54 - 3.285, 1.960, 1.322, 1.028, 0.820 Not alot of difference but was wondering, if it is possible to swap these, whether the accel difference would be noticeable? Celica is GT basically standard just alloys, exhaust and short ram. Remap Ecu at some point soon, is chipping the Ecu the same thing? Cheers guys, Dan |
